Declutter and Organize for a Clear Mind

Decluttering and organizing your space is a crucial step in creating a mindful home. When our physical environment is cluttered and disorganized, our minds tend to mirror that chaos. By clearing out the unnecessary and organizing our belongings, we can create a sense of clarity and calmness within ourselves.

Start by assessing each area of your home and identifying items that are no longer serving a purpose or bringing you joy. Be ruthless in your decision-making process, letting go of things that no longer align with your current lifestyle or goals. Remember, decluttering is not just about getting rid of physical objects; it’s also about letting go of emotional baggage and creating space for new experiences.

Once you have decluttered, it’s time to organize what remains. Find effective storage solutions that suit your needs and preferences. Whether it’s using baskets, bins, or labeled containers, find a system that works for you and helps keep your belongings in order.

Maintaining an organized space is just as important as the initial decluttering process. Create daily or weekly routines to tidy up, ensuring that everything has its designated place. The act of organizing and maintaining order in your home can be a meditative practice in itself, allowing you to cultivate a clear and focused mind.

By decluttering and organizing your space, you are setting the stage for a mindful home that promotes peace and tranquility. It is the foundation upon which you can build other mindful practices and create a nurturing environment for self-reflection and growth.

Incorporate Natural Elements for Serenity

Incorporating natural elements for serenity is the next step in creating a mindful home. Just as decluttering and organizing set the stage for a peaceful environment, bringing the outdoors in can further enhance the tranquility of your space. By connecting with nature through the integration of natural elements, you create a sense of harmony and balance that can positively impact your overall well-being.

One way to incorporate natural elements is by introducing plants into your home. Not only do they add a touch of greenery and beauty, but they also improve air quality and provide a calming effect. Research has shown that being in the presence of plants can reduce stress and anxiety, while also promoting feelings of relaxation and focus. Consider placing potted plants strategically throughout your home, such as in the living room, bedroom, or even in the bathroom, to infuse your space with a sense of serenity.

In addition to plants, natural materials can also contribute to the peaceful ambiance of your home. Opt for furniture, flooring, and decor made from materials like wood, bamboo, or natural fibers such as cotton or linen. These elements not only add a touch of nature but also bring warmth and texture to your surroundings. Incorporating natural materials not only creates visual appeal but also provides a tactile experience that promotes a sense of connection and grounding.

Furthermore, consider introducing natural light into your home. Open up the curtains or blinds during the day to allow sunlight to stream in, illuminating your space with its gentle glow. Natural light has been proven to boost mood, increase productivity, and regulate our circadian rhythm. By harnessing the power of natural light, you create an atmosphere of calmness and clarity within your home.

By incorporating natural elements into your living environment, you pave the way for a mindful home that exudes serenity. From the soothing presence of plants to the use of natural materials and the utilization of natural light, these elements work together to create a harmonious space for self-reflection and growth. Create a Tranquil Atmosphere with Lighting

To further enhance the tranquility of your mindful home, it’s important to pay attention to the lighting within your space. The right lighting can create a soothing and calming atmosphere that promotes relaxation and mindfulness. Consider using soft, warm lighting options rather than harsh, bright overhead lights.

One way to achieve this is by incorporating lamps with warm-toned bulbs that emit a soft, gentle glow. These kinds of lighting fixtures can help to create a cozy and tranquil ambiance in your home. Place them strategically throughout your space, focusing on areas where you spend a lot of time, such as the living room or bedroom.

In addition to lamps, consider utilizing candles to add a touch of serenity to your environment. The flickering flame not only provides a soft and inviting glow but also creates a sense of warmth and comfort. Opt for natural, unscented candles to avoid overwhelming your senses and maintain a calming atmosphere.

Another important aspect of creating a tranquil atmosphere with lighting is to have control over the intensity and color of the light. Install dimmer switches or use smart bulbs that allow you to adjust the brightness according to your preference and needs. This flexibility puts you in control of the ambiance and helps you curate the perfect setting for your mindful practices.

By paying attention to the lighting in your home and creating a tranquil atmosphere, you set the stage for a space that is conducive to mindfulness and self-reflection. The next step in our journey towards a mindful home is to design a dedicated space for our mindful practices, where we can fully immerse ourselves in the present moment and find inner peace. This space doesn’t have to be grand or elaborate; it can be as simple as a comfortable corner with a cushion, a cozy chair, or even a small yoga mat.

When designing this space, consider incorporating elements that promote relaxation and focus. Natural materials like bamboo or wood can infuse a sense of tranquility, while soft textures and neutral colors create a soothing ambiance. Introduce elements from nature, such as plants or natural artwork, to bring a connection to the outside world and evoke a sense of grounding.

In addition to the physical design, consider how you can enhance the sensory experience in this space.

Soft, calming music or the gentle sounds of nature can create a serene backdrop for your mindful practices. Aromatherapy diffusers or scented candles can fill the air with soothing scents like lavender or eucalyptus, promoting a sense of relaxation and centering.

By intentionally designing a space dedicated to your mindful practices, you provide yourself with a sanctuary where you can retreat from external noise and immerse yourself in the present moment. It becomes a sacred space that cultivates stillness, reflection, and ultimately, a deeper connection with yourself.
